Across the Philippines themselves, activity reaches a minimum in February, before increasing steadily through June and spiking from July through October, with September being the most active month for tropical cyclones across the archipelago. [13] A typhoon has wind speed of 6479 knots (7391mph; 118149km/h), a severe typhoon has winds of at least 80 knots (92mph; 150km/h), and a super typhoon has winds of at least 100 knots (120mph; 190km/h). The least activity seen in the northwest Pacific Ocean was during the 2010 Pacific typhoon season, when only 14tropical storms and seven typhoons formed. Since the eddy circulations in the ocean which are induced by tropical cyclones and the sea-surface temperature decreases may persist for many days after a storm's passage, the behavior of subsequent storms which cross the modified ocean surface may be affected, although the small area of significant sea surface temperature decreases makes a large influence unlikely.
